The ubiquitin activating enzyme E1 (UBE1) plays a crucial role in the ubiquitin-proteasome pathway, which is essential for regulating protein degradation and maintaining cellular homeostasis. UBE1 catalyzes the initial step of ubiquitin conjugation by adenylating the C-terminal glycine residue of ubiquitin in an ATP-dependent manner, forming a thiolester bond with a cysteine residue on UBE1. This activated ubiquitin is subsequently transferred to a ubiquitin-conjugating enzyme, which then donates the ubiquitin moiety to target substrates, marking them for degradation. Proper functioning of UBE1 is vital, as dysregulation of this pathway can lead to various diseases, including cancer and neurodegenerative disorders. Notably, the UBE1 gene is an example of an X-Y homologous gene, being X-linked with a distinct Y-linked counterpart in many mammals, although no UBE1 homolog is found on the human Y chromosome. UBE1 is believed to escape X inactivation in humans, which may have implications for gene dosage and expression in females.

Can UBE1 (2G2): sc-53555 monoclonal antibody be used in IF or IHC with mouse tissue or cells? Will there be non-specific staining?

Asked by: jenniferc
Thank you for your inquiry. The use of mouse monoclonal antibodies with mouse samples is very common and typically poses no problem. To eliminate any potential cross-reactivity of an anti-mouse secondary detection reagent, UBE1 (2G2): sc-53555 is available in a variety of direct conjugations, such as HRP, PE, FITC and AlexaFluors.
